Cheesy Ground Beef and Potatoes Recipe
A hearty and flavorful dish that combines ground beef, potatoes, and melted cheddar cheese in a satisfying one-pan meal.

Ground Beef:
Seasonings:
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 3 medium pot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up beef broth
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
- Cook Ground Beef: Heat olive oil in a skillet, cook ground beef until browned.
- Saute Onion and Garlic: Add onion and garlic to the skillet, cook until softened.
- Add Potatoes and Seasonings: Add potatoes, salt, pepper, paprika, and oregano. Stir to combine.
- Cook with Broth: Pour in beef broth, cover, and cook until potatoes are tender.
- Melt Cheese: Sprinkle cheddar cheese over the mixture, cover, and cook until melted.
- Garnish and Serve: Garnish with parsley before serving.
